12-05-2020, 09:55 AM
CDN – Content delivery Network là màng lưới gồm phổ thông Server được khai triển tại rộng rãi Data center khác nhau. Tiêu chí của CDN là phục vụ User có tính sẵn sàng và ổn định cao. Ngày nay, CDN được sử dụng để cung cấp nội dung rất rộng rãi, sở hữu phổ quát mẫu nội dung khác nhau, bao gồm Web (chữ, hình ảnh và script), những đối tượng với thể download được (Media file, software, tài liệu), ứng dụng, live-stream media, và cả mạng phường hội.
CDN rõ ràng là xương sống của toàn cầu internet trong việc luân chuyển nội dung. Cho dù chúng ta sở hữu biết đến sự còn đó của nó hay không, chúng ta vẫn đang tương tác có CDN mỗi hàng ngày: khi đang sắm tậu online, đọc báo, xem Youtube, hay thậm chí là đọc post này ????
ko quan trọng bạn khiến cho gì hoặc sử dụng nội dung nào, bạn sẽ vẫn thấy với sự hiện diện cua CDN đằng sau mỗi con chữ, pixel hình ảnh và mỗi thước phim được chuyển tới trên trình duyệt y và PC của mình.
Để hiểu tại sao CDN lại được dùng phổ biến như vậy, bạn cũng cần nên biết chúng sinh ra để khắc phục cái gì? Đó là Latency (độ trễ), là khoảng thời kì bị delay khi bạn request một trang web cho tới khi nội dung được chuyển tới trên màn hình.
Khoảng delay này chịu ảnh hưởng bởi phổ thông nhân tố, với thể vài thành phần sẽ khác nhau tuỳ trang web. Tuy nhiên, gần như trong số này là do khoảng bí quyết vật lý từ đồ vật của bạn cho đến máy chủ đang host trang web. Và nhiệm vụ chính yếu của CDN là phải làm cho “giảm” khoảng cách thức này lại, tăng tốc độ xử lý và hiệu năng của trang web.
>>> Xem thêm: mua máy chủ rx4770 fujitsu
CDN hoạt động như thế nào?
Để giảm khoảng bí quyết trong khoảng user truy tìm cập và Server, một mạng CDN lưu nội dung cache tại phổ thông địa điểm khác nhau (thường được gọi là PoP – Point of Presence). Mỗi PoP bao gồm những caching Server, chịu nghĩa vụ cho việc truyền tải nội dung tới những user ở gần nhất.
thực chất thì CDN lưu nội dung tại phổ thông địa điểm cùng một khi, bao phủ các vùng user sở hữu thể tróc nã cập vào. Chả hạn, khi ai đấy ở Hà Nội truy cập vào một trang web được host tại Sài Gòn, đề xuất sở hữu thể được xử lý duyệt y PoP tại Hà Nội. Tốc độ xử lý sẽ mau lẹ hơn đa dạng, so mang việc User sẽ phải “đi” từ Bắc vào Nam.
doanh nghiệp nào sử dụng khoa học CDN?
hiện tại, hơn 1 nửa traffic trên Internet đều được dùng CDN, và Báo cáo này cứ tiếp tục tăng qua từng năm. Thực tại thì nếu đơn vị của bạn đã online rồi thì với rất ít lí do để mà ko dùng CDN, thêm nữa, nếu như chịu khó search Google thì cũng mang một số công ty offer miễn phí nhà cung cấp của họ (hoặc dùng thử).
Nhưng nếu tổ chức bạn đang chạy những website, hệ thống chỉ dành chuyên dụng cho cho khách địa phương thôi, cùng vị trí địa lý với những hosting Server, thì CDN sở hữu thể không mang lại phổ biến lợi ích về tốc độ (vì phải tạo ra một kết nối ko cần thiết giữa PoP và user).
thường ngày, các website được vận hành có mức độ to, việc lựa chọn CDN được các cấp sau sử dung:
các thành phần chính của CDN
PoP – Point of Presence
PoP là các Data Center được đặt một bí quyết hợp lý, chịu phận sự giao du mang User trong vùng lân cận. Chức năng chính là giảm thời gian delay bằng việc đem nội dung tới gần hơn tới quý khách. Mỗi PoP thường cất đa số caching Server.
Caching Server
Caching Server chịu nghĩa vụ cho việc lưu trữ và truyền vận chuyển những File đã được Cached. Phận sự chính là tăng tốc độ load của website và giảm tiêu tốn băng thông. Mỗi caching Server thường với Storage và RAM rất cao.
SSD/HDD + RAM
Trong mỗi CDN caching Server, các File được cached sở hữu thể lưu trên HDD hoặc SSD hoặc RAM. Trong số này, RAM được dùng để lưu các item mà truy hỏi cập thường xuyên nhất.
ích lợi lúc dùng CDN
khi đề cập tới CDN, ta chỉ thường nghe những ưu thế trong việc chuyển phát nội dung, ngoài ra mạng CDN cũng có những lợi ích khác:
CDN rõ ràng là xương sống của toàn cầu internet trong việc luân chuyển nội dung. Cho dù chúng ta sở hữu biết đến sự còn đó của nó hay không, chúng ta vẫn đang tương tác có CDN mỗi hàng ngày: khi đang sắm tậu online, đọc báo, xem Youtube, hay thậm chí là đọc post này ????
ko quan trọng bạn khiến cho gì hoặc sử dụng nội dung nào, bạn sẽ vẫn thấy với sự hiện diện cua CDN đằng sau mỗi con chữ, pixel hình ảnh và mỗi thước phim được chuyển tới trên trình duyệt y và PC của mình.
Để hiểu tại sao CDN lại được dùng phổ biến như vậy, bạn cũng cần nên biết chúng sinh ra để khắc phục cái gì? Đó là Latency (độ trễ), là khoảng thời kì bị delay khi bạn request một trang web cho tới khi nội dung được chuyển tới trên màn hình.
Khoảng delay này chịu ảnh hưởng bởi phổ thông nhân tố, với thể vài thành phần sẽ khác nhau tuỳ trang web. Tuy nhiên, gần như trong số này là do khoảng bí quyết vật lý từ đồ vật của bạn cho đến máy chủ đang host trang web. Và nhiệm vụ chính yếu của CDN là phải làm cho “giảm” khoảng cách thức này lại, tăng tốc độ xử lý và hiệu năng của trang web.
>>> Xem thêm: mua máy chủ rx4770 fujitsu
CDN hoạt động như thế nào?
Để giảm khoảng bí quyết trong khoảng user truy tìm cập và Server, một mạng CDN lưu nội dung cache tại phổ thông địa điểm khác nhau (thường được gọi là PoP – Point of Presence). Mỗi PoP bao gồm những caching Server, chịu nghĩa vụ cho việc truyền tải nội dung tới những user ở gần nhất.
thực chất thì CDN lưu nội dung tại phổ thông địa điểm cùng một khi, bao phủ các vùng user sở hữu thể tróc nã cập vào. Chả hạn, khi ai đấy ở Hà Nội truy cập vào một trang web được host tại Sài Gòn, đề xuất sở hữu thể được xử lý duyệt y PoP tại Hà Nội. Tốc độ xử lý sẽ mau lẹ hơn đa dạng, so mang việc User sẽ phải “đi” từ Bắc vào Nam.
doanh nghiệp nào sử dụng khoa học CDN?
hiện tại, hơn 1 nửa traffic trên Internet đều được dùng CDN, và Báo cáo này cứ tiếp tục tăng qua từng năm. Thực tại thì nếu đơn vị của bạn đã online rồi thì với rất ít lí do để mà ko dùng CDN, thêm nữa, nếu như chịu khó search Google thì cũng mang một số công ty offer miễn phí nhà cung cấp của họ (hoặc dùng thử).
Nhưng nếu tổ chức bạn đang chạy những website, hệ thống chỉ dành chuyên dụng cho cho khách địa phương thôi, cùng vị trí địa lý với những hosting Server, thì CDN sở hữu thể không mang lại phổ biến lợi ích về tốc độ (vì phải tạo ra một kết nối ko cần thiết giữa PoP và user).
thường ngày, các website được vận hành có mức độ to, việc lựa chọn CDN được các cấp sau sử dung:
- quảng cáo.
- tiêu khiển và Media.
- Game Online.
- thương nghiệp điện tử.
- Y tế và giáo dục.
- Hệ thống Chính phủ
- Mobile
các thành phần chính của CDN
PoP – Point of Presence
PoP là các Data Center được đặt một bí quyết hợp lý, chịu phận sự giao du mang User trong vùng lân cận. Chức năng chính là giảm thời gian delay bằng việc đem nội dung tới gần hơn tới quý khách. Mỗi PoP thường cất đa số caching Server.
Caching Server
Caching Server chịu nghĩa vụ cho việc lưu trữ và truyền vận chuyển những File đã được Cached. Phận sự chính là tăng tốc độ load của website và giảm tiêu tốn băng thông. Mỗi caching Server thường với Storage và RAM rất cao.
SSD/HDD + RAM
Trong mỗi CDN caching Server, các File được cached sở hữu thể lưu trên HDD hoặc SSD hoặc RAM. Trong số này, RAM được dùng để lưu các item mà truy hỏi cập thường xuyên nhất.
ích lợi lúc dùng CDN
khi đề cập tới CDN, ta chỉ thường nghe những ưu thế trong việc chuyển phát nội dung, ngoài ra mạng CDN cũng có những lợi ích khác:
- nâng cao tốc load hình ảnh.
- Xử lý lưu lượng traffic cao.
- Block những Spammer, scraper và những thể loại bot xấu xa khác
- Giảm lượng tiêu thụbăng thông.
- Load balance giữa những Server
- Phòng chống DDOS, tăng an ninh cho vận dụng.